Melaka Health Dept denies collecting money outside of health premises
Melaka Health Director Datuk Dr Rusdi Abd Rahman has said the department has only collected money for health services at existing health facilities. – Rusdi Abd Rahman Facebook pic, March 4, 2023

MELAKA – The state Health Department and its personnel have never gone around collecting money from business premises to fund the association’s bulletin.

State Health Director Datuk Dr Rusdi Abd Rahman said money was only collected for health services provided at existing health facilities.

“The Melaka Health Department received public complaints on Friday regarding irresponsible parties claiming to be health personnel going to business premises and collecting money for the purpose of funding the association’s bulletin.

“The department’s investigation found that the association is not listed under the supervision of the (Health Ministry) and a police report has been made,” he said in a statement today.

He said the public can contact the Melaka Health Department at 06-235-6999 if they have any inquiries or complaints. – Bernama, March 4, 2023
